why is caffeine unlikely to cross through the phospholipid bilayer?

Respuesta :

raduoprea160
raduoprea160 raduoprea160
  • 20-12-2020

Because caffeine is a big polar molecule and it can't pass directly through the phospholypid bilayer so it needs to pass through a channel.
